May 2022 Windows Updates may cause issues with NPS and RRAS
Theldron replied to free780's topic in Enterprise Software
Just had 4 days of nightmares because of this update. Had no wifi in one school and patchy wifi that kept dropping out at another school. None of the actual warning signs listed by Microsoft were present in the environments and the affected services have been completely different. But the out of bands patch for this update fixed both schools.
